Manohar Aich was an Indian bodybuilder of post independence era and he was popular for his body building with self disciplined life style. Manohar Aich is about 4 feet 11 inches tall. He was given the name "Pocket Hercules". His chest measured 54 inches (140 cm) with a waist of 23 inches (58 cm). He was also nicknamed "Bahubali".
Early Life of Manohar Aich
Manohar Aich was born in the Tipperah District (now the Comilla District in Bangladesh) on March 17, 1912. He was the second Indian after Monotosh Roy in 1951 to win any Mr. Universe title and the first Indian to win the title post-independence.
Career of Manohar Aich
Manohar Aich at the age of 12 suffered a sudden attack of black fever when his health broke down. He regained his strength, however, by physical fitness exercises. He started bodybuilding exercises such as doing push-ups, squats, pull-ups, leg raises and traditional sit-ups. He only did bodyweight exercises with up to 100 reps per set at that age. He attended the Jubilee School in Dhaka. While at school, he used to go to the Ruplal Byayam Samiti for physical exercises. He began to perform in shows titled Physique and Magic along with P. C. Sorcar in Dhanbad. He used to perform feats like bending steel with his teeth, bending spears with his neck and resting his belly on swords.
Later Career of Manohar Aich
Manohar Aich joined the Royal Air Force or in Indian Army in 1942 where he began his pursuit in bodybuilding. He was introduced to weight training by Reub Martin, a British officer in the RAF. By that time, however, he had built his structure with prolonged hard work and dedication. Due to his physique, he was highly praised by British RAF officials. While part of the RAF, Manohar Aich was imprisoned for slapping a British officer in protest at the officer`s remarks in favour of colonial oppression. Manohar Aich began his weight training seriously while in jail. Manohar Aich would spend hours in physical exercises. Observing his knack in physical culture, the jail authorities arranged a special diet for him.
Awards Received by Manohar Aich
In 1950, at the age of 36, Manohar Aich won the Mr. Hercules contest. In 1951, Manohar Aich stood second in the Mr. Universe contest. In 1952 he placed first in the Pro-Short division of the NABBA Mr. Universe. Manohar Aich also won the World Championship of Spring Pulling by tearing a spring of 275 pounds tension. In 1955 he stood third in the Mr. Universe contest. In 1960 he stood fourth in the Mr. Universe contest at the age of 46 years. He did many bodybuilding shows from 1960. His last show was performed at 2003 at the age of 89.
Political Career of Manohar Aich
In 1991, Manohar Aich had also contested elections for the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) and finished third, collecting over 163,000 votes. Also, in 2015, Manohar Aich was given the Banga Bibhushan Award by the West Bengal Government
Death of Manohar Aich
On 5th June 2016, Manohar Aich died in Kolkata, aged 104 years.
